The Graffiti album itself was released on December 8, 2009, by Jive Records. The project was recorded over the course of 2008 and 2009 with several high-profile record producers, including Polow da Don, Swizz Beatz, The Runners, and Brian Kennedy. The album was a follow-up to his successful second album, Exclusive (2007).

Serving as the second single, "Crawl" is an emotional, mid-tempo R&B ballad. The track features heartfelt vocals from Brown as he sings about the slow, painful process of rebuilding a broken relationship.
